Hi,
as said, you need to do manual changes to your deployed nodes.
then you will have to:
- synch your galera cluster across the two dc
- configure properly the load balancers
- configure the memcached configuration
- register the services of the second region on the new shared keystone

Br,
Federico

PS: I think that you can change the region name in the YAML file using fuel
cli (
https://docs.mirantis.com/openstack/fuel/fuel-7.0/user-guide.html#cli-usage),
but that won't help much honestly, being the trivial of the steps above.
